Just cause I have one. lol. The last of the carb, roller motor, serpentine belt system, shorter throw stock shifter, improved tranny gears (1st gear anyway) stock Holley carb, more horse than all(up to 87) little less torque than 86,nicer steering wheel,quad shocks. The front end only same for 85&86 the suspension sway bars etc are all HD compared to earlier years. The only carbed roller cam Stang ever built, there are more but that is a start. I like all of them but 87-93 are very common but in time will change. I like mine because it lacks power options AC,less wires etc making it lighter and where I am, soon it will be exempt from emissions testing Any others can add to the reasons they are so great, feel free.

Well I for one love the 85/86 models...

85 was the last year for carbs the first year for the roller cam, made good power & had the best front end (85& 86 front end was only around 2 years).
86 was the first year for fuel injection first year for the 8.8 rear & last year for that particular front end /interior.

The whole reason I chose an 86 is b/c IMO the interior looks WAY better than the 87+ interiors, it was still fuel injection & had all the "good things" that the 87+ had. It was a little down on power b/c the 86 heads & intake
but since I was planning on modifying it anyhow what did I care.
